How many heartbeats in a typical human lifetime? Enter answer as a number ( not as a power of ten) and in one significant figure.

Let the average life span of the human life is 80 years,

Total number of heart beat in 1 min =72

Hence total number of heartbeat =80yr×(365days1yr)×(24hour1days)×(60min1hr)×(72heartbeat1min)=80 yr\times (\frac{365 days}{1 yr})\times (\frac{24 hour}{1 days})\times (\frac{60min}{1 hr})\times (\frac{72 heart beat}{1 min})

=3027456000=3027456000
